Why Charlotte runs above the North Carolina average

Construction wages in Charlotte average $27.54 per hour against $26.42 statewide, so labor-heavy work prices above the North Carolina norm here.

Labor is about 42% of the installed cost on this type of work, and it is the part that actually moves between markets. Materials are priced by national manufacturers and barely shift, which is why the gap between metros is narrower than wage differences alone suggest.

Ground conditions and code in Charlotte

Charlotte sits in IECC zone 4 (mixed) with a design frost depth of about 12 inches. Footings and posts must extend below that line, which adds excavation depth and concrete volume that warm-climate estimates leave out.

Permits in Charlotte

A residential permit for this work typically runs around $400 in North Carolina. Permit cost is rarely included in a contractor quote, so budget it separately and confirm scope with the Charlotte building department before work begins.

Methodology. Local pricing applies the Charlotte construction wage from the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(2025 release, $27.54/hr) to the labor share of a national 2026 cost baseline. Materials are held at national prices. Figures refresh automatically with each BLS release. Planning estimates, not quotes. See our full methodology.
